It's well written but I have to take one major issue with the book that greatly bothers me. That issue is the transliteration of G-d's name. Much like when we read Torah or any of our liturgy with the actual name of G-d we substitute it with one of many titles. (Adonai, Adoshem, Elokem, HaShem, etc etc) This observance is done out of reverence for G-d's holy name. By printing the name transliterated using the English alphabet it leads the high potential for the disrespectful or casual use of G-d's name.I know most people who are buying this book are probably either not Jewish or more on the secular side. However on the path to learning or teaching Torah respect for the name of G-d is a very important issue. After all it's one of the mitzvot found in the ten commandments to not use the name in vain. Ironic that in a book teaching Torah this mitzvah is over looked.We received this book as a gift but I'm still not sure if I will use this book for our children for this one issue. Should we use the book we will do the same as we do in Hebrew and when coming across the name we will replace it with Adonai. Perhaps the first mitzvah to be taught before embarking on this read.

When I received a review copy of With a Mighty Hand: The Story in the Torah, I swooned. At a time when the printed word seems to be hanging in the balance, and the Nones (those with no religious affiliation) are a newsworthy phenomenon, it was more than heartening to read this beautiful volume, an illustrated retelling of Bible stories. In hardback no less!Candlewick Press deserves high praise for publishing this beautiful volume.In author Amy Ehrlich's capable hands, the stories in the Torah (the Hebrew Bible) come to life in vivid prose that hews quite close to the original text. Ehrlich distills the Five Books of Moses into a single narrative. Children's bible stories often focus on those passages rich with visual potential--while skipping the darker side of these stories. This is not your father's Golden Bible version. Ehrlich presents the Torah in full: animals marching two by two and Noah drunk from wine, exposed in nakedness to his son Ham. Recounted are the days of creation as well as Adam and Eve's blame-shifting conversation with God after they ate the forbidden fruit. What an opportunity to talk to a child about taking responsibility for one's actions and the all-too-human tendency to lay blame elsewhere.Reading the Tree of Knowledge chapter this time around, I saw something new in the text. The serpent's punishment is to crawl upon the ground, metaphorically eating dust all the days of his life. Dust figures in Adam's fate as well: He will not live forever but will return to dust. Eve, however, is punished not with dust, nor with bearing children in pain as I have always understood it. She is punished with a multiplication of the pain of her childbirth. This passage, as presented by Ehrlich, raises two questions. What does it mean that Eve's punishment has nothing to do with dust? And second, was Eve's punishment lighter than Adam's and the snake's? Admittedly, childbirth is no walk in the park, but the text seems to be telling us that God would multiply a pain that was already Eve's destiny come childbirth. The snake lost its legs, left to crawl belly-to-dirt for all time and Adam lost eternal life in the Garden, both consequences that had no mirror pre-forbidden fruit.Daniel Nevins, the artist chosen to illustrate the book, has done glorious work. His paintings have a depth and solidity in both his figures and in his color palette that echo well the seriousness of the text. There is poignancy, too. Nevins' illustration of Moses, post Golden Calf, is heart-breaking. The father of this wayward tribe of Hebrews kneels prostrate upon the ground, his staff and the tablets are strewn upon the earth beside him. Moses, one hand on the ground, one resting upon the back of his head, holds a posture of such submission and defeat that one can almost hear him weeping in fury and frustration. Nevins rendered the splitting of the Sea of Reeds as a double-page spread with the yabasha, the dry ground, turning the interior of the book's spine into part of the Israelites' path to freedom. The whitecaps of the waves reach like hands from the confines of the pages. He was a marvelous choice to bring these stories to visual life.There are any number of reasons why I'm eager for grandchildren one day. With a Mighty Hand gives me another reason. I dream of quiet afternoons and evenings reading portions of this beautiful book with them, visiting and revisiting the text, exploring the illustrations, discussing the moral issues inherent in each chapter. The Hebrew Bible is a storybook like no other, as relevant today as the day it was given, because its stories speak to us all. I look forward to the day it speaks to my children's children.
